All courses …the Bioengineering undergraduate curriculum has the objective to prepare students to achieve their post-baccalaureate goal of a) an industrial career in bioengineering or related field; b) graduate school (M.S. and Ph.D. programs related to bioengineering); or c) professional school (Medical, Dental, Health-Related, Business, and Law).Five components in the BME curriculum deliver the knowledge and technical depth expected for all BME graduates: Multiscale core courses. Four courses that step through BME principles from atomic to organ scales including quantitative multiscale biology, physiology, and pathology. Experiential learning. Throughout the curriculum, core coursework becomes progressively more integrative across the disciplines and in years three and four, students specialize in a chosen bioengineering subdiscipline. The program is distinguished by laboratory courses that provide diverse experiences and hands-on skills as well as a capstone design course in which ...
